Frederik Meijer Gardens & Sculpture Park Announces 2025 Calendar of Events Celebrating 30 Years and 120 Seasons


News provided by

Frederik Meijer Gardens & Sculpture Park

Jan 14, 2025, 05:15 ET

Share this article

Share toX

Share this article

Share toX

Frederik Meijer Gardens & Sculpture Park in Grand Rapids, Michigan
Frederik Meijer Gardens & Sculpture Park in Grand Rapids, Michigan

New Year Highlighted by Sculpture Exhibitions 'BUSTED: Contemporary Sculpture Busts' and 'Jaume Plensa: A New Humanism'

GRAND RAPIDS, Mich., Jan. 14, 2025 /PRNewswire-PRWeb/ -- Frederik Meijer Gardens & Sculpture Park, one of the world's most visited cultural and horticultural destinations, announces its 2025 calendar of events, celebrating a landmark "120 Seasons" and continuing its commitment to promoting art, culture, and nature. Meijer Gardens also will commemorate its 30th anniversary with birthday cake for guests on April 20, 2025.

In addition to perennial favorites like The Fred & Dorothy Fichter Butterflies Are Blooming, Fifth Third Bank Summer Concerts at Meijer Gardens, MUMS at Meijer Gardens, and The University of Michigan Health-West: Christmas & Holiday Traditions, the year will be punctuated by sculpture exhibitions of national significance, including BUSTED: Contemporary Sculpture Busts (April 4-Sept. 21) and Jaume Plensa: A New Humanism (Oct. 24, 2025-March 15, 2026). ENLIGHTEN also returns for a second year in November with all-new lighting and musical elements.

"We are thrilled to embark on our 30th year of creating unforgettable experiences for guests from around the world," said Charles Burke, President & CEO of Meijer Gardens. "As a place where art, culture, and nature come together, Meijer Gardens offers something truly special for everyone."

Featured Annual Exhibitions and Special Events:

  • David Smith: The Nature of Sculpture: through March 2
  • BUSTED: Contemporary Sculpture Busts: April 4–Sept. 21. A unique sculpture exhibition, featuring contemporary busts by celebrated artists.
  • Fred & Dorothy Fichter Butterflies Are Blooming: March 1–April 30. The annual butterfly exhibition returns, transforming the Lena Meijer Tropical Conservatory into a colorful sanctuary with thousands of tropical butterflies.
  • Ayers Basement Systems Tuesday Evening Music Club: Tuesdays, June 17–August 26, 7-9 pm. Featuring diverse local and regional artists in an intimate setting, Tuesday evenings are ideal for enjoying music outside in a scenic atmosphere.
  • Fifth Third Bank Summer Concerts at Meijer Gardens: Various dates, lineup announced in April. A beloved tradition, these concerts bring top musicians to the Frederik Meijer Gardens Amphitheater all summer long.
  • MUMS at Meijer Gardens: Oct. 1–31. MUMS at Meijer Gardens showcases Michigan's largest display of chrysanthemums. This vibrant exhibition features fall programming, Tuesday evening events and thousands of garden and specialty mums in stunning autumn colors.
  • Autumn Nights at Meijer Gardens: Tuesdays in October, 5-9 pm. Guests enjoy evening hours and special programming amidst autumn beauty.
  • Jaume Plensa: A New Humanism: Oct. 24–March 15, 2026. This exhibition explores the artist's career-long engagement with universal human themes such as dreams, desire, justice and mortality. Featuring both monumental sculptures and more intimate works, this is the first U.S. retrospective of this internationally celebrated artist.
  • University of Michigan Health-West: Christmas & Holiday Traditions: Nov. 26–Jan 4, 2026. The signature holiday exhibition returns with international décor, displays and traditions, engaging programming, and a festive atmosphere.
  • ENLIGHTEN at Meijer Gardens: Nov. 26–Jan. 3, 2026. This immersive experience returns, featuring a stunning one-mile illuminated pathway with innovative light displays, enchanting music, interactive experiences, and world-renowned sculpture.
